namespace Pango
{

/** A Pango::Color is used to represent a color in an uncalibrated RGB colorspace.
 */
class Color
{
  public:
#ifndef DOXYGEN_SHOULD_SKIP_THIS
  using CppObjectType = Color;
  using BaseObjectType = PangoColor;
#endif /* DOXYGEN_SHOULD_SKIP_THIS */

  Color(const Color& other) noexcept;
  Color& operator=(const Color& other) noexcept;

  Color(Color&& other) noexcept;
  Color& operator=(Color&& other) noexcept;

  /** Get the GType for this class, for use with the underlying GObject type system.
   */
  static GType get_type() G_GNUC_CONST;

  Color();

  explicit Color(const PangoColor* gobject); // always takes a copy

  ///Provides access to the underlying C instance.
  PangoColor*       gobj()       { return &gobject_; }

  ///Provides access to the underlying C instance.
  const PangoColor* gobj() const { return &gobject_; }

protected:
  PangoColor gobject_;

private:
  
  
public:

  #ifndef PANGOMM_DISABLE_DEPRECATED

  /// @deprecated Use the const version.
  explicit operator bool();
  #endif // PANGOMM_DISABLE_DEPRECATED


  /// Tests whether the Color is valid.
  explicit operator bool() const;
  
  /** Gets the red component of the color.
   * @return The red component of the color. This is a value between 0 and 65535, with 65535 indicating full intensity.
   */
  guint16 get_red() const;

  /** Gets the green component of the color.
   * @return The green component of the color. This is a value between 0 and 65535, with 65535 indicating full intensity.
   */
  guint16 get_green() const;

  /** Gets the blue component of the color.
   * @return The blue component of the color. This is a value between 0 and 65535, with 65535 indicating full intensity.
   */
  guint16 get_blue() const;

  /** Sets the red component of the color.
   * @param value The red component of the color. This is a value between 0 and 65535, with 65535 indicating full intensity.
   */
  void set_red(const guint16& value);

  /** Sets the green component of the color.
   * @param value The green component of the color. This is a value between 0 and 65535, with 65535 indicating full intensity.
   */
  void set_green(const guint16& value);

  /** Sets the blue component of the color.
   * @param value The blue component of the color. This is a value between 0 and 65535, with 65535 indicating full intensity.
   */
  void set_blue(const guint16& value);

  
  /** Fill in the fields of a color from a string specification. The
   * string can either one of a large set of standard names. (Taken
   * from the X11 &lt;filename&gt;rgb.txt&lt;/filename&gt; file), or it can be a hex value in the
   * form '#rgb' '#rrggbb' '#rrrgggbbb' or '#rrrrggggbbbb' where
   * 'r', 'g' and 'b' are hex digits of the red, green, and blue
   * components of the color, respectively. (White in the four
   * forms is '#fff' '#ffffff' '#fffffffff' and '#ffffffffffff')
   * 
   * @param spec A string specifying the new color.
   * @return <tt>true</tt> if parsing of the specifier succeeded,
   * otherwise false.
   */
  bool parse(const Glib::ustring& spec);

  
  /** Returns a textual specification of @a color in the hexadecimal form
   * <tt>#rrrrggggbbbb</tt>, where <tt>r</tt>,
   * <tt>g</tt> and <tt>b</tt> are hex digits representing
   * the red, green, and blue components respectively.
   * 
   * @newin{1,16}
   * 
   * @return A newly-allocated text string.
   */
  Glib::ustring to_string() const;


};

} /* namespace Pango */
